Q&A

  • Abstract Error는 어떤 에러입니까?


안뇽 하신가여 고수님들 위의 에러가 몬가여???



지가 라디오버튼을 배열을 써서 생성시키는디...



먼저



메인폼의 콤보박스3의 아템인덱스를 선택하면...



SUB폼이 나와서리... 그 SUB폼의 라디오그룹박스에 라디오버튼들이 동적으로 생성



됨당..... 이상하게두 첫번째 할때는 괜찮은디 두번째 부터는 이에러가 계속 나오네여



저 에런 몬가여... 궁금함당... 분명 free도 다해줬는디 말임당...^^



그럼 여러고수님들의 고견을 기댕김당...^^

1  COMMENTS
  • Profile
    최용일 2000.09.07 11:21
    안녕하세요. 델파이세상(http://www.freechal.com/delphiworld)의 최용일입니다.



    Abstract method를 호출하셨나보네요...



    Abstract method란게 뭐냐면... 음... 그 클래스에서 선언은 되어 있지만 구현은 되어



    있지 않은 메소드로 그 자손클래스에서 다양하게 구현되는 메소드를 말합니다.



    TStream을 예를 들면 Read란 추상메소드가 있습니다. 물론 TStream.Read는 아무런 일도



    하지 않죠. 그 파생 클래스인 TFileStream의 Read는 파일에서 데이타를 읽고 또 다른



    파생클래스인 TMemoryStream의 Read는 메모리에서 데이타를 읽죠.



    이러한 추상메소드를 가진 추상클래스는 직접적으로 인스턴스를 만들어서 사용하지 않고



    그 파생클래스의 인스턴스를 만들어서 사용합니다.



    아마도 TRadioGroup의 Items속성(TStrings)가 가진 추상메소드를 사용하신것 같군요...



    실질적으로 TRadioGroup.Items속성은 TStrings의 파생 클래스인 TStringList를 생성해



    서 사용합니다.



    ^^ 항상 즐코하세요.



    사발우성 wrote:

    >

    > 안뇽 하신가여 고수님들 위의 에러가 몬가여???

    >

    > 지가 라디오버튼을 배열을 써서 생성시키는디...

    >

    > 먼저

    >

    > 메인폼의 콤보박스3의 아템인덱스를 선택하면...

    >

    > SUB폼이 나와서리... 그 SUB폼의 라디오그룹박스에 라디오버튼들이 동적으로 생성

    >

    > 됨당..... 이상하게두 첫번째 할때는 괜찮은디 두번째 부터는 이에러가 계속 나오네여

    >

    > 저 에런 몬가여... 궁금함당... 분명 free도 다해줬는디 말임당...^^

    >

    > 그럼 여러고수님들의 고견을 기댕김당...^^